Since its founding in 1993, NVIDIA (NASDAQ: NVDA) has been a pioneer in accelerated computing. The company’s invention of the GPU in 1999 sparked the growth of the PC gaming market, redefined computer graphics, ignited the era of modern AI and is fueling the creation of the metaverse. NVIDIA is now a full-stack computing company with data-center-scale offerings that are reshaping industry.

Job description

Will you be part of the team that helps our partners to develop customer solutions using the latest NVIDIA full stack accelerated computing platform? NVIDIA defines and delivers the computing infrastructure of today and tomorrow. We are committed that these infrastructures deliver the highest value to our customers who own and operate these infrastructures.

We are looking for a team leader to operationalize the latest technologies at NVIDIA by bridging the gap between prototype models and production-ready deployment plans. The team will drive initial deployment setup, prepares sites, establishes product feedback loops to design engineering teams, assembles validation data, resolves obstacles, applies workarounds, and details deployment plans. They lead all aspects of making the latest NVIDIA products and systems functional by capturing install and bring-up evidence, handle the validation process, describe blockers, and find solutions to deploy AI Factories globally.

What you will be doing:

  • Recruit & manage a team of solutions architects, system/network and software engineers focused on large-scale GPU and AI networking deployments.

  • Set priorities, allocate resources, mentor, and ensure high-quality customer delivery across multiple concurrent projects - while remaining directly involved in key technical reviews, design decisions, and critical debug efforts.

  • Provide deep subject-matter expertise in advanced GPU and network systems and serve as the senior technical point of contact for strategic customers.

  • Personally lead and guide complex compute/network configuration and performance debugging, working side-by-side with your team to deliver performant, reliable clusters.

  • Guide your team as they lead network / compute / software architecture discussions, and support server, network, and cluster bring-up, including on-site data center work where needed.

  • Systematically collect and synthesize customer-specific requirements across your portfolio.

  • Partner with GPU/Network Systems Engineering, Product Management, and Sales to influence roadmap priorities and packaging of reference designs and solutions.

  • Demonstrate SME in advanced GPU & network systems and be a trusted technical advisor to NVIDIA's strategic customers. Bring customer-specific requirements to product teams to guide product roadmap features.

  • Identify new project opportunities for NVIDIA products and technology solutions in data center and AI applications. Work closely with the GPU/Network Systems Engineering, Product management and Sales teams

What we need to see:

  • BS/MS/PhD in Electrical/Computer Engineering, Computer Science, Physics, or other Engineering fields or equivalent experience.

  • 8+ overall years in Systems/Solutions/Field Engineering, Network or Data Center Engineering, or similar roles, with 2+ years leading or mentoring engineers or architects (formal manager or strong tech lead).

  • System-level expertise across CPU/GPU server architecture, NICs, Linux, system software, and kernel drivers.

  • Experience with data center networking (Ethernet and/or InfiniBand switches, fabrics, and associated tooling) and familiarity with data center infrastructure (power, cooling, deployment constraints).

  • Proven ability to lead technical teams, set priorities, and drive complex projects from design through production.

  • Demonstrated success working with Product Management, Sales, and Engineering.

  • Strong time management skills and ability to balance planning with hands-on support where needed.

  • Excellent written and verbal communication, including the ability to lead customer meetings, communicate status and risks, and produce clear design docs, debug summaries, and presentations.

Ways to stand out from the crowd:

  • Direct people management & recruiting experience for geographically distributed technical teams.

  • Track record leading bring-up and deployment of large clusters or supercomputing environments.

  • Background in external customer-facing roles (field engineering, escalations, or pre/post-sales architecture).

  • Systems engineering, coding, and debugging skills including experience with C/C++, Linux kernel and drivers

  • Hands-on experience with NVIDIA GPU systems and SDKs (e.g., CUDA), NVIDIA networking technologies (NICs, RoCE, InfiniBand), and/or ARM-based CPU solutions as well as familiarity with virtualization and cloud-native networking concepts.

We make extensive use of conferencing tools, but occasional (30%) travel is required for on-site visit to customers and industry events. We are open to remote work location and look forward to have you join our team!

Your base salary will be determined based on your location, experience, and the pay of employees in similar positions. The base salary range is 184,000 USD - 287,500 USD for Level 3, and 216,000 USD - 345,000 USD for Level 4.
